Jack Dorsey Seeks Tax Exemption for Daily Bitcoin Transactions, Cynthia Lummis Highlights Her Proposed Legislation
Written by Ohris M. Greyoon, Blockchain & Crypto Expert
Support for Bitcoin Tax Relief: Senator Cynthia Lummis endorsed Jack Dorsey's proposal for a tax exemption on small Bitcoin transactions, referencing her own legislation that aims to exempt gains from transactions up to $300, with an annual cap of $5,000.
Concerns Over Tax Limits: While the proposed legislation has garnered support, some users expressed that the transaction limits are too low, and there are ongoing debates about whether cryptocurrency transactions should be taxed at all.
